重慶阿里云代理商:ASP無法寫入數(shù)據(jù)庫表的解決方案及阿里云優(yōu)勢
在日常的Web開發(fā)過程中,許多開發(fā)者都可能遇到ASP程序無法寫入數(shù)據(jù)庫表的問題。這個問題往往讓開發(fā)人員頭痛不已,但如果使用阿里云提供的云服務,解決此類問題將變得更簡單。本文將通過分析ASP無法寫入數(shù)據(jù)庫表的常見原因,結(jié)合阿里云的優(yōu)勢,為開發(fā)者提供有效的解決方案。
一、ASP無法寫入數(shù)據(jù)庫表的原因
ASP(Active Server Pages)是一種服務器端腳本技術(shù),廣泛應用于動態(tài)網(wǎng)頁開發(fā)。但在實際開發(fā)過程中,ASP無法寫入數(shù)據(jù)庫表的問題常常由以下幾個原因?qū)е拢?/p>
1. 數(shù)據(jù)庫連接問題
ASP程序通過ADO(ActiveX Data Objects)進行數(shù)據(jù)庫連接,如果數(shù)據(jù)庫連接字符串配置不正確,或者數(shù)據(jù)庫服務未啟動,都會導致無法與數(shù)據(jù)庫進行有效的交互。
2. 數(shù)據(jù)庫權(quán)限問題
數(shù)據(jù)庫用戶權(quán)限不足也是導致無法寫入數(shù)據(jù)庫表的常見問題。例如,數(shù)據(jù)庫用戶沒有INSERT權(quán)限,或者數(shù)據(jù)庫沒有對ASP應用開放適當?shù)臋?quán)限,都會影響數(shù)據(jù)的寫入。
3. 數(shù)據(jù)庫表結(jié)構(gòu)問題
如果數(shù)據(jù)庫表的結(jié)構(gòu)發(fā)生變化,或者數(shù)據(jù)類型不匹配,ASP程序嘗試寫入數(shù)據(jù)時會出現(xiàn)錯誤。確保表結(jié)構(gòu)與ASP程序中傳遞的數(shù)據(jù)類型一致是至關(guān)重要的。
4. 文件權(quán)限問題
有時,數(shù)據(jù)庫所在的文件夾權(quán)限設(shè)置不當,導致ASP程序無法對數(shù)據(jù)庫文件進行寫入操作。確保文件系統(tǒng)和數(shù)據(jù)庫的權(quán)限設(shè)置正確,以便ASP能夠執(zhí)行所需的操作。
二、阿里云優(yōu)勢分析
在解決ASP無法寫入數(shù)據(jù)庫表的問題時,阿里云提供了強大的云計算服務和技術(shù)支持,能夠有效幫助企業(yè)解決各種數(shù)據(jù)庫和服務器問題。以下是阿里云的一些關(guān)鍵優(yōu)勢:
1. 強大的云數(shù)據(jù)庫服務
阿里云提供了多種數(shù)據(jù)庫服務,包括關(guān)系型數(shù)據(jù)庫(RDS)、NoSQL數(shù)據(jù)庫、Redis等,支持MySQL、SQL Server、PostgreSQL等常見數(shù)據(jù)庫。通過阿里云數(shù)據(jù)庫,開發(fā)者可以輕松創(chuàng)建、管理和優(yōu)化數(shù)據(jù)庫,無需擔心硬件或配置問題。
2. 高可用性與數(shù)據(jù)安全
阿里云的云服務擁有高可用性架構(gòu),數(shù)據(jù)庫的高可用性配置使得即使在某些節(jié)點出現(xiàn)故障時,系統(tǒng)仍然能夠正常運行。除此之外,阿里云提供的數(shù)據(jù)加密、備份和恢復等功能,保障了數(shù)據(jù)的安全性。
3. 便捷的數(shù)據(jù)庫管理控制臺
阿里云提供直觀的管理控制臺,開發(fā)者可以方便地對數(shù)據(jù)庫進行配置和監(jiān)控。例如,用戶可以輕松配置數(shù)據(jù)庫連接、權(quán)限、表結(jié)構(gòu)等,快速發(fā)現(xiàn)并解決數(shù)據(jù)庫操作問題??刂婆_還提供了豐富的日志和監(jiān)控工具,幫助開發(fā)者定位故障并優(yōu)化系統(tǒng)。
4. 彈性伸縮與自動化運維
阿里云的云服務具有彈性伸縮能力,能夠根據(jù)流量的變化自動調(diào)整資源。此外,阿里云還提供了自動化運維服務,減少了人工操作,提高了系統(tǒng)的穩(wěn)定性和維護效率。
5. 全面的技術(shù)支持和服務
阿里云提供24小時的技術(shù)支持,無論是服務器配置、數(shù)據(jù)庫優(yōu)化,還是故障排查,阿里云的技術(shù)團隊都能為開發(fā)者提供及時的幫助。此外,阿里云還提供了豐富的學習資源和文檔,幫助開發(fā)者快速上手并解決各種技術(shù)難題。
三、解決ASP無法寫入數(shù)據(jù)庫表的問題
在阿里云的幫助下,開發(fā)者可以輕松解決ASP無法寫入數(shù)據(jù)庫表的問題。具體步驟包括:
1. 檢查數(shù)據(jù)庫連接字符串
確保ASP程序中的數(shù)據(jù)庫連接字符串配置正確,并且指向阿里云RDS的地址??梢栽诎⒗镌瓶刂婆_中獲取連接信息,并驗證防火墻設(shè)置是否允許ASP程序訪問數(shù)據(jù)庫。
2. 配置正確的數(shù)據(jù)庫權(quán)限
在阿里云RDS管理控制臺中,檢查數(shù)據(jù)庫用戶是否具備足夠的權(quán)限。如果沒有,使用管理員賬號進行權(quán)限配置,確保ASP應用能夠執(zhí)行INSERT操作。
3. 確保表結(jié)構(gòu)與數(shù)據(jù)一致
檢查數(shù)據(jù)庫表結(jié)構(gòu),確保字段類型與ASP程序中的數(shù)據(jù)類型一致。如果字段類型不匹配,可能導致數(shù)據(jù)插入失敗。
4. 檢查文件系統(tǒng)權(quán)限
確保數(shù)據(jù)庫文件所在的云服務器具有適當?shù)奈募L問權(quán)限。阿里云的云服務器提供了靈活的權(quán)限管理功能,能夠確保ASP程序與數(shù)據(jù)庫之間的順暢交互。
四、總結(jié)
在面對ASP無法寫入數(shù)據(jù)庫表的問題時,通過阿里云提供的強大云計算和數(shù)據(jù)庫服務,開發(fā)者可以輕松解決大多數(shù)技術(shù)難題。阿里云不僅提供穩(wěn)定的云數(shù)據(jù)庫和高可用性架構(gòu),還能為開發(fā)者提供靈活的資源配置和高效的運維管理工具。此外,阿里云的技術(shù)支持團隊全天候為開發(fā)者提供服務,確保在遇到問題時能夠及時得到幫助。

通過利用阿里云的優(yōu)勢,開發(fā)者不僅能夠高效解決ASP數(shù)據(jù)庫連接問題,還能夠優(yōu)化系統(tǒng)性能,提升網(wǎng)站的穩(wěn)定性和用戶體驗。因此,選擇阿里云作為云服務平臺,是提升開發(fā)效率和保障系統(tǒng)穩(wěn)定性的明智之選。
這篇文章以HTML格式寫成,內(nèi)容涵蓋了“ASP無法寫入數(shù)據(jù)庫表”的常見原因、解決方案,以及阿里云的優(yōu)勢,最后給出了總結(jié)。希望這篇文章能夠為你提供幫助!